Battery-Free Wireless Keyboard

Overview

A wireless keyboard powered by keystrokes. Each press converts mechanical energy into electrical energy to transmit signals, eliminating charging and battery replacement. Stable per-keystroke transmission improves reliability and user experience while reducing cost and battery waste.

Problem addressed

Conventional wireless keyboards depend on batteries, creating replacement and recycling burdens and generating waste. In special-use scenarios—healthcare, industrial control, fieldwork, or long unattended operation—charging or battery depletion can cause interruptions and unstable performance, reducing reliability when consistent input is critical.

Innovation
  • Converts keystroke mechanical energy into electrical energy to power wireless signal transmission.
  • Mechanical potential-energy pre-charging and power management enable stable, efficient energy delivery for every key press.
  • Operates without batteries or external charging and does not rely on solar or RF power harvesting, improving consistency in diverse settings.
Key impact
  • Zero batteries reduce maintenance and downtime, lowering recurring cost and improving convenience.
  • Lower latency and more stable performance than solar- and RF-driven keyboard solutions.
  • Reduced battery waste supports a more sustainable device lifecycle.
  • Instant per-keystroke energy supply improves reliability and input consistency.

The Chinese University of Hong Kong (CUHK)

Founded in 1963, The Chinese University of Hong Kong (CUHK) is a forward-looking comprehensive research university with a global vision and a mission to combine tradition with modernity, and to bring together China and the West. CUHK teachers and students hail from all around the world. Four Nobel laureates are associated with the university, and it is the only tertiary institution in Hong Kong with recipients of the Nobel Prize, Turing Award, Fields Medal and Veblen Prize sitting as faculty in residence. CUHK graduates are connected worldwide through an extensive alumni network. CUHK undertakes a wide range of research programmes in many subject areas, and strives to provide scope for all academic staff to undertake consultancy and collaborative projects with industry.
